After two games on the road, Jackson South Side is heading back home. They will take on the Macon County Tigers at 4:00 p.m. on Saturday. Hopefully Jackson South Side is not getting complacent considering they own a much higher rank in Tennessee (they are ranked 48th, while Macon County is ranked 137th).
Last Wednesday, Jackson South Side was able to grind out a solid victory over Chester County, taking the game 31-23.
Jackson South Side's victory was a true team effort, with many players turning in solid performances. Perhaps the best among them was Zandria Cohill, who scored eight points along with eight rebounds and three steals. Ri'Kiya Mitchell was another key contributor, scoring eight points along with six steals and five rebounds.
Meanwhile, Macon County was within striking distance but couldn't close the gap on Wednesday as they fell 43-39 to Station Camp.
Macon County's loss shouldn't obscure the performances of Laityn Kirby, who scored ten points, and Katie Jo shockley who scored seven points.
Jackson South Side has been performing incredibly well recently as they've won 12 of their last 13 matchups, which provided a nice bump to their 25-6 record this season. As for Macon County, they have not been sharp recently as the team has lost seven of their last nine games, which put a noticeable dent in their 19-13 record this season.
Saturday's match is shaping up to be a masterclass in shooting: Jackson South Side have been dynamite from deep this season, having made 39.5% of their threes per game. However, it's not like Macon County struggles in that department as they've made 42.9% of their threes this season.
